Have you first tried a non-DFS channel, like 149+ or below 54? DFS is hardwired into the radio chipset to cut out when it interferes with local radar and other official broadcasts on its frequency.
There have been apparent crashes with the “nas” WiFi processes on northstar recently. So, that could be a potential cause, as well.
